information about the author of Romans 12:10

Romans 12:10 states: “Be devoted to one another in love. Honor one another above yourselves.” This verse is part of Paul’s letter to the Romans, traditionally attributed to the Apostle Paul.

From an evangelical Christian perspective, Paul’s authorship of Romans is widely accepted based on historical and textual evidence. Paul, who was originally a Pharisee and a persecutor of Christians, underwent a dramatic conversion experience on the road to Damascus (Acts 9). Following this event, he became one of the most influential leaders in the early Christian church, known for his missionary journeys and theological writings.

The letter to the Romans is significant as it provides a comprehensive explanation of Paul’s theology, addressing themes such as salvation, grace, and the nature of the church. Romans 12 emphasizes practical Christian living in light of the truths established in the earlier chapters, and it calls believers to live out their faith with love and humility.

Evangelicals often highlight the emphasis on community and relational dynamics found in this verse. The call to “be devoted to one another in love” reflects Jesus’ teaching on love as a central commandment and underscores the importance of unity and mutual respect among believers.

Overall, Romans 12:10, and the letter as a whole, has had a profound impact on Christian thought and practice, emphasizing the necessity of genuine love and honor within the Christian community.
